Indian defender Rupinder Pal Singh emerged a hero as his hat-trick gave the India A Men's Hockey Team a 5-1 victory against Bangladesh in the final practice match played at the Sports Authority of India, Bengaluru Campus.
The experienced drag-flicker scored three goals in the 24th, 47th and 60th minutes, giving the team a 1-0 lead in the second quarter after Bangladesh had made a good start that kept India 'A' from scoring in the first quarter.
Gurjinder Singh followed Pal Singh and scored a goal in the 27th minute. The other goal scorer for India 'A' was Vikas Dahiya, who opted to play as a forward instead of a goalkeeper in today's match.
For Bangladesh, Mohammad Ashraful Islam scored the team's lone goal through a penalty corner in the 53rd minute.
